/*
11.3. OpenPGP Messages
An OpenPGP message is a packet or sequence of packets that
corresponds to the following grammatical rules (comma represents
sequential composition, and vertical bar separates alternatives):
OpenPGP Message :- Encrypted Message | Signed Message | Compressed Message | Literal Message.
Compressed Message :- Compressed Data Packet.
Literal Message :- Literal Data Packet.
ESK :- Public-Key Encrypted Session Key Packet | Symmetric-Key Encrypted Session Key Packet.
ESK Sequence :- ESK | ESK Sequence, ESK.
Encrypted Data :- Symmetrically Encrypted Data Packet | Symmetrically Encrypted Integrity Protected Data Packet
Encrypted Message :- Encrypted Data | ESK Sequence, Encrypted Data.
One-Pass Signed Message :- One-Pass Signature Packet, OpenPGP Message, Corresponding Signature Packet.
Signed Message :- Signature Packet, OpenPGP Message | One-Pass Signed Message.
In addition, decrypting a Symmetrically Encrypted Data packet or a
Symmetrically Encrypted Integrity Protected Data packet as well as
decompressing a Compressed Data packet must yield a valid OpenPGP
Message.
*/
public:
enum Token { // Rules
OPENPGPMESSAGE,
ENCRYPTEDMESSAGE,
SIGNEDMESSAGE,
COMPRESSEDMESSAGE,
LITERALMESSAGE,
ESK,
ESKSEQUENCE,
ENCRYPTEDDATA,
ONEPASSSIGNEDMESSAGE,
// Symbols
CDP, // Compressed Data Packet (Tag 8)
LDP, // Literal Data Packet (Tag 11)
PKESKP, // Public-Key Encrypted Session Key Packet (Tag 1)
SKESKP, // Symmetric-Key Encrypted Session Key Packet (Tag 3)
SEDP, // Symmetrically Encrypted Data Packet (Tag 9)
SEIPDP, // Symmetrically Encrypted Integrity Protected Data Packet (Tag 18)
OPSP, // One-Pass Signature Packet (Tag 4)
SP, // Signature Packet (Tag 2)
NONE // garbage value
};
